dextro-looped transposition of the great arteries (DOID:0060770)
Alliance: disease page
Synonyms: congenitally uncorrected transposition of the great arteries; congenitally uncorrected transposition of the great vessels; D-TGA; DTGA1; isolated ventriculoarterial discordance; ventriculoarterial discordance with atrioventricular concordance
Alt IDs: OMIM:608808, ICD10CM:Q20.3, ORDO:860
Definition: A congenital heart disease characterized by complete inversion of the great vessels where the aorta incorrectly arises from the right ventricle and the pulmonary artery incorrectly arises from the left ventricle.
